Nest Learning Thermostat

A great first example of the future of all home automation is the Nest thermostat. Nest installs on your wall like any other thermostat (though it looks way cooler) but uses sensors, algorithms, machine learning and cloud computing to figure out what you want. It looks at the time, the temperature, the day of the week and other factors. It notices what time you get up, go to work and come home, what temperature you prefer and when you prefer it.

It has smart settings for when you’re away. And you can override the automated controls with an app on your phone. — Mike Elgan
